Title: Godefridus N Verspaget: Innovator in Electric Lamp Technology
Introduction
Godefridus N Verspaget is a notable inventor based in Eindhoven, Netherlands. He has made significant contributions to the field of electric lamp technology, holding a total of 5 patents. His work has focused on improving the efficiency and functionality of electric lamps and luminaires.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is for an electric lamp that features a glass lamp vessel with seals from which an external metal wire extends. This design includes a bare corrosion-resistant contact wire that is welded to the external metal wire, allowing for secure electrical connections to a luminaire to be made easily and rapidly. Another significant patent involves a luminaire that consists of a pair of lamp holders and contact members designed for mechanically and electrically mounting a double-ended electric lamp. This innovative design ensures a fast and secure electrical connection of the lamp.
Career Highlights
Godefridus N Verspaget is associated with U.S. Philips Corporation, where he has contributed to various advancements in lighting technology. His work has been instrumental in enhancing the performance and reliability of electric lamps.
Collaborations
He has collaborated with notable coworkers such as Hendrikus A Van Dulmen and Mathijs H Loomans, contributing to a dynamic team focused on innovation in lighting solutions.
